WP Rollback 3.0.8: A Maneira Mais Segura de Reverter Versões de Plugins e Temas no WordPress
Desvendando o WP Rollback: Seu Aliado na Gestão de Versões do WordPress
No dinâmico mundo do WordPress, manter plugins e temas atualizados é fundamental para a segurança e performance do seu site. No entanto, nem toda atualização acontece sem imprevistos. Erros de compatibilidade, funcionalidades quebradas ou até mesmo falhas fatais podem surgir, transformando o que deveria ser uma melhoria em um verdadeiro pesadelo. É nesse cenário que o plugin WP Rollback se torna uma ferramenta indispensável, oferecendo uma solução simples e eficaz para reverter (ou avançar) plugins e temas para qualquer versão desejada.
O Que é o WP Rollback e Por Que Você Precisa Dele?
O WP Rollback é um plugin que simula o processo de atualização do WordPress, mas com uma diferença crucial: ele permite que você escolha a versão específica para a qual deseja reverter um plugin, tema ou bloco do WordPress.org. Esqueça a complicação de baixar arquivos manualmente, usar FTP ou lidar com Subversion. Com apenas alguns cliques, você pode restaurar uma versão anterior, corrigindo rapidamente problemas causados por atualizações recentes. É a ferramenta perfeita para desenvolvedores e proprietários de sites que buscam um controle mais granular sobre suas instalações.
Para aqueles que necessitam de recursos mais avançados, como suporte a plugins e temas premium (Envato, Kadence Pro, Astra Pro, etc.), registro abrangente de atividades, suporte a redes multisite e atendimento prioritário, existe a versão WP Rollback Pro, expandindo ainda mais as capacidades deste poderoso plugin.
Segurança em Primeiro Lugar: Teste e Faça Backup Sempre
Embora o WP Rollback torne o processo de reversão incrivelmente fácil, é fundamental adotar as precauções adequadas. Este plugin não deve ser usado sem antes garantir que você possui backups completos do seu site e que realizou testes em um ambiente de desenvolvimento ou staging. Não há garantias de que uma versão mais antiga funcionará como esperado, e a responsabilidade por qualquer perda de dados ou tempo de inatividade recai sobre o administrador do site. Use o WP Rollback como uma ferramenta para facilitar o processo, mas sempre com um plano de contingência.
Instalação e Requisitos Mínimos do WP Rollback
Instalar o WP Rollback é um processo direto. Para a instalação automática, basta acessar o painel do WordPress, navegar até “Plugins” > “Adicionar Novo”, pesquisar por “WP Rollback” e clicar em “Instalar Agora”. O WordPress se encarregará do restante. Se preferir a instalação manual, você pode baixar o plugin e fazer o upload via FTP para a pasta “wp-content/plugins”.
Para garantir o funcionamento adequado, o WP Rollback requer:
- WordPress 6.5 ou superior
- PHP 7.4 ou superior
- MySQL 5.0 ou superior
Perguntas Frequentes Sobre o Uso do WP Rollback
Uma das principais dúvidas é sobre a segurança do plugin. Sim, o WP Rollback é seguro, pois ele simplesmente instala versões publicamente disponíveis de plugins e temas. A segurança, no entanto, depende da sua cautela como administrador: sempre teste em ambiente de staging e faça backups. Outra questão comum é por que o botão de “Rollback” não aparece em alguns plugins/temas. A resposta é que o WP Rollback funciona apenas com itens instalados do repositório oficial WordPress.org, não suportando plugins de GitHub, ThemeForest ou outras fontes. A documentação completa pode ser encontrada no site do WP Rollback, e a diferença entre as versões Free e Pro reside nas funcionalidades avançadas já mencionadas, como suporte a itens premium e multisite.
Novidades e Melhorias no WP Rollback 3.0.8 e Anteriores
O WP Rollback está em constante evolução, e a versão 3.0.8 reflete o compromisso dos desenvolvedores com a estabilidade e compatibilidade. As atualizações recentes trouxeram uma série de correções e aprimoramentos significativos, tornando a ferramenta ainda mais robusta e confiável para a gestão de versões no WordPress.
Versão 3.0.8: Mais Compatibilidade e Estabilidade
A versão mais recente, 3.0.8, focou em uma correção crucial: a alteração do tipo de sistema de arquivos no BackupService de `WP_Filesystem_Direct` para `WP_Filesystem_Base`. Esta mudança visa ampliar a compatibilidade com diversas implementações de sistema de arquivos, garantindo que o plugin funcione sem problemas em uma gama ainda maior de ambientes de hospedagem.
Versão 3.0.7: Suporte Aprimorado a Permissões de Arquivo
A versão 3.0.7 trouxe uma melhoria importante no manuseio de permissões de arquivo. Foi atualizada a chamada `WP_Filesystem` no BackupService para permitir `Group/World writable files`, evitando problemas potenciais com permissões de arquivo durante as operações de backup. Essa correção, sugerida por um usuário do fórum de suporte do WP.org, aumenta a robustez do plugin.
Versão 3.0.6: Otimização de Performance e Correção de Erros Críticos
Esta versão entregou um ganho de performance significativo ao evitar a recriação de arquivos para plugins e temas premium se um arquivo já existir para a versão atual, otimizando o processo de atualizações e reversões. Além disso, corrigiu um erro crítico que causava falhas fatais em plugins com autoloaders (como o WooCommerce) durante o rollback. Agora, o plugin é desativado corretamente antes da exclusão, prevenindo erros de PHP.
Versão 3.0.5: Modo de Manutenção Inteligente e Melhorias na UI
A 3.0.5 aprimorou o modo de manutenção, garantindo que ele só seja ativado para visitantes regulares do site, sem interferir em ferramentas de monitoramento externo (Nagios, WP-CLI) ou verificações automatizadas do WordPress. Além disso, o modo de manutenção agora só é acionado ao reverter plugins ou temas ativos, e a interface do usuário foi corrigida para exibir corretamente a etapa do modo de manutenção na versão gratuita, com um código mais fácil de manter.
Versão 3.0.4: Modo de Manutenção e Melhorias para Multisite
Esta versão introduziu o modo de manutenção durante as operações de rollback, seguindo os padrões do Core do WordPress, e incluiu uma limpeza automática para garantir que o site nunca fique preso nesse modo. Também resolveu a validação restritiva de pacotes que impedia plugins com nomes de arquivo principais não padrão (ex: Visual Composer) de serem revertidos. Correções importantes para instalações Multisite também foram implementadas, abordando erros fatais com WP CLI, carregamento de scripts/estilos e validação de pacotes ZIP.
Versão 3.0.3: Correções de Erros Essenciais
A versão 3.0.3 focou em resolver um erro fatal ao tentar reverter plugins com o campo `requires_php` retornando um valor booleano falso em vez de uma string. Além disso, corrigiu a exibição de nomes de plugins e temas contendo entidades HTML, garantindo que apareçam corretamente nas modais de rollback.
Versão 3.0.2 e 3.0.1: Otimizações de UI e Resolução de Conflitos
A 3.0.2 simplificou a exibição dos botões de rollback de temas, garantindo que todos os temas os exibam sem verificar a disponibilidade no WordPress.org. Unificou os manipuladores JavaScript para uma manutenção de código mais fácil e removeu a distinção visual entre links de rollback. A 3.0.1, por sua vez, corrigiu um erro com JetPack Sync e outros plugins que modificam dados de plugins e podem retornar nulo.
Versão 3.0.0: Uma Renovação Completa
A versão 3.0.0 marcou um marco importante, introduzindo uma interface de usuário completamente redesenhada e mais moderna. Adicionou novos itens de menu “WP Rollback” em Ferramentas, com visualizações de lista para selecionar plugins e temas mais facilmente. Passou a armazenar ativos premium localmente no servidor para acesso futuro e atualizou o plugin para suportar versões de PHP de 7.4 a 8.4, garantindo ampla compatibilidade e uma experiência de usuário aprimorada.


